## Tuning encoding detection

When users report garbled uploads in Textrune, the detector (Charmsniff) is almost always the culprit, not the file. It samples a fixed byte window, scores candidate encodings, and falls back to UTF-8 if confidence is low. Support can request a server-side re-detect with a larger window before escalating. Raising confidence thresholds reduces mojibake but increases fallback misfires on short files. The knobs support can reference on tickets are listed below.

constants for tafog-kahag:
RATE_LIMITS = {
    "sorir": 697,
    "oliox": 683,
    "holax": 176,
    "casox": 60,
    "pelius": 382,
}

Handover Note – Directors, Tarnwell Fabrication

For the finance team's records: I am passing the Line 4 capacity decision to my successor. Current utilisation sits at 87%; the proposed extension at the Dunmere plant would add 30% throughput at a cost already modelled in the Q3 pack. Supplier quotes expire at month end, so a decision is needed promptly. The confidential planning note is appended immediately below.

management briefing: Only 5 of the 80 pilot accounts renewed Zorix, so a churn review is set for October 1.

The DrumDrop locker API requires support agents to authenticate before querying a customer's drop-off status. All requests go through the internal AccessRelay service, which validates the key and logs the lookup for audit purposes. Rate limits are generous, but bulk exports need manager approval. For troubleshooting sessions in the support console, use the shared internal key below.

API key for fafog-tahog: kto7_xIy0cQG